Q: Is 674,364,025 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 674,364,025 is not a prime number.

Why is 674,364,025 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 674364025 can be evenly divided by 1 5 23 25 115 575 1,172,807 5,864,035 26,974,561 29,320,175 134,872,805 and 674,364,025, with no remainder.

Since 674,364,025 cannot be divided by just 1 and 674,364,025, it is not a prime number.
